BETTAHALASUR: Bettahalsur is a census town in Bangalore Urban district in Indian state of Karnataka. It is located in the central part of the Southern tip of India approximately 300 kilometers from both east and west coast. It is located at 12.97° north latitute and 77.59° east longitude. The area falls under temperate climate zone: Temperature : 30°C - 34°C (Summer) 27°C -33°C (Winter) Relative Humidity : 60% Precipitation : Less than 1000mm Sky condition : Mainly clear, ocassionally overcast with dense clouds in summer. Parrots on door frames: The parrots are a case in point. First, I asked the house owners about the parrot design. Invariably they said that the parrots represent the harmony between the family members. I wish to add that there is a possibili ty that the community would identify itself with the parrot. The train of thought could have been that their nature was similar to that of this bird, or they thought it was a threat to them because parrots eat paddy. By identifying themselves with the parrot possible harm caused by the parrot would be controlled. There is a remarkable correspondence between the Bunts as cultivators settling in a place with strong residence and parrots who also build a strong nest. A similar structural explanation is given by Brouwer (2021) where he discusses the case of the Kodavas who were hunters and food gatherers originally and who had travelled for a long time before settling in Kodagu. Even after settling they practiced hunting for a long time and did not believe in making a permanent residence just like how a peacock does not build a proper nest for laying its eggs. They identify themselves with peacocks which idea can be seen in the iconography of their dagger that the Kodava groom wears on his waist during the wedding. Also, the married women wear a’ pathak’ (which is not a ’tali’/nuptial thread) that has a cobra hood not only as a fertility symbol, but also to ward off snakes. One can find the earliest examples of birds placed in the centre of door frames in the temples of Guptha em pire during 4-6 th century and the birds were referred to as ‘magalya vihaga’.
Description of the images based on my research during Dissertation: Pillars and nomenclature of various parts: There are two kinds of pillars that are prominent in the Bunts community in and around Mangalore.
Type 1: One which is square in shape. The various parts of this pillar (from base to top) include; (i) ‘Padhuke’, the base (ii)’ Jagathi’, square in shape and is the lower half of the pillar (iii)’ Vajana’, is the part above ‘jagathi’ which is octagonal in shape (iv) ‘Dala’, it is located after ‘vajana’ (v) ‘Melina vajana’ (vi) ‘Prathi’/’bodige’, is the capital of the pillar.
Type 2: One which is bulbous. The various parts of the pillar include: (i)’ Padhuke’, the base (ii) The main bulbous body (iii) ‘Dala’ (can have two dala’s sometimes) (iv) ‘Melina vajana’ (not always present) (v) ‘Prathi’/’bodige’, is the capital of the pillar The base (padhuke) is usually has simple design while the lower half of the pillar (jagathi) has no carving on it except for a small portion at upper end where the octagonal part (vajana) starts. This portion usually has patterns of knitted mat enclosed with the design of a chain (sankale) or a flower petal or foliage (esal) design or, some cases, just has simple lines running around it. The ‘vajana’ has pointed corners where it intersects with ‘jagathi’.These can be simple or sometimes ornamented on the borders. The ‘jagathi’ can be plain or it is extensively carved with flutes and more intricate designs displayed on the base and top of the flutes, usually the top of the flute has arches combined with intricate floral design. In general the ‘dala’ is simple, but sometimes it has a pear necklace (manisara) carved around it. ‘Melina vajana’ has inverted pointed corners and is simple or has a floral design all around it, or just consists only of plain lines. Usually the ‘prathi’ is the head of ‘makhara’ stretching its tongue out, but sometimes it is hypotenuse that is triangular in shape with curves running through it. The tongue is usually extensively carved with a floral design (esal), but sometimes it shows some animals
